The Property
This Sabberton built property is in good condition throughout with spacious and flexible accommodation that would suit a variety of different purchasers, painted soft wood double glazing throughout, gas central heating with under floor heating on the ground floor. The entrance hall welcomes one into the property with a storage cupboard with ample space for coats and boots. The living room has a floor to ceiling brick built fireplace with coal effect gas fire which is the main focal point of the room, double doors lead out to the rear garden. There are double doors on the opposite side of the room which lead through to the conservatory which can also be accessed by the hallway. The study is fully fitted with a storage cupboard, two desks and shelving units. The playroom/dining room is spacious and has views on to the rear garden. The kitchen/diner is of very good proportion, and is fully fitted with a range of wooden units, stainless steel sink and drainer, fitted oven and dishwasher. The utility room has wooden units and a stainless steel sink and drainer, plumbing for washing machine and a storage cupboard, doors lead out to the rear garden and into the double garage. Downstairs there is also a shower room with white sink and WC and a walk in shower. The master bedroom has a separate dressing area with a fitted wardrobe and a fully tiled en-suite bathroom with wooden panel bath, sink and WC fitted into a vanity unit with cupboards and shelving. There are three further double bedrooms all with fitted wardrobes, and one with a small hand basin. The family shower room is fully tiled with a glass shower cubical, a vanity unit with inset sink and WC.

Location
Barnby is a small village close to the market town of Beccles and within easy reach of Lowestoft. In the village there is a good general store/Post Office, primary school, two public houses, two churches and a Methodist chapel. All the other necessary amenities can be found in Beccles approx 3 miles distant which provides a good variety of shops, supermarkets, restaurants, railway station (with connections to London Liverpool Street via Ipswich), banks, sporting and leisure facilities, schools, doctors, dentists and access to The River Waveney and part of the Broads Navigable Waterways System. The unspoilt Suffolk coastline is a short drive away with the beautiful beaches at Southwold and Walberswick.
